Star Indian batter Rinku Singh, who is fast making his mark as a regular member of the Indian T20I team and one of the best batters in world cricket in the shortest format of the game, picked four Indian players when asked to name his favourite batter.

In an interaction with News24 Sports, Rinku unsurprisingly named India’s ODI and Test captain Rohit Sharma as well as former skipper Virat Kohli. The duo have been playing for the national team for more than a decade and are widely among the two greatest batters in Indian cricket history.

Rinku further named one left-hander, Suresh Raina, whom he shares a close bond with and hails from his same state, Uttar Pradesh. The 26-year-old picked India's newly appointed T20I captain Suryakumar Yadav as his fourth pick and stated that the 33-year-old's batting style is unique.

"Raina bhai. Rohit bhaiya has so much time to play. Virat bhaiya. Surya bhai. He is completely different. He plays shots which no one else can play," said Rinku.

Rinku Singh Eyes Test And ODI Spot

After being left out of India's T20 World Cup squad despite his incredible record for the Men in Blue, Rinku was recalled to the team and played all eight matches against Zimbabwe and Sri Lanka. Rinku was key to India's win in their final T20I against Sri Lanka, as he was given the ball by skipper Suryakumar in a surprise move and responded by taking two wickets in the 19th over of the match. This was the first time Rinku bowled for India in the shortest format.

However, Rinku was dropped from the ODI squad against Sri Lanka despite playing India's previous ODI series against South Africa in December 2023. Rinku was left out of all four Duleep Trophy squads in spite of playing for India-A in unofficial Test matches against South Africa-A and England Lions recently and having a first-class average of more than 50 with the bat.
